Madera Mechanical was incorporated by the three principals in June of 1983. The first year of business was contracted as a closed or union shop. As of July 1, 1984, Madera Mechanical elected to become merit or open shop and has continued to operate as an open shop. The corporation has contracted for over 105 million dollars of work in Arizona and Nevada with numerous General Contractors. All contracts have been completed on time using craftsmen skilled in their work. Madera Mechanical has earned many repeat contracts because of its ability to perform as required. In 1992, Madera Mechanical expanded into Fire Protection and has continued to grow in this area. In 1997 Madera began procuring work in Las Vegas, Nevada and relocating some key employees to Nevada. This division has grown significantly in the nine years we have been there. In 2002, Madera Mechanical obtained licensing to furnish and install HVAC. We purchased over $250,000 worth of HVAC fabrication equipment and set up a large, modern and efficient sheet metal fabrication shop adjacent to our fire sprinkler shop. Our HVAC fittings are laid out and cut by a state of the art computer controlled plasma cutter. All of our divisions have AutoCAD capability and our estimating and design build departments utilize the latest versions of software on their computers for project design and estimating. We are proficient and specialize in design build projects. We offer a complete mechanical design, budget, and installation for our clients. Our customers and project owners prefer to have one qualified contractor perform the fire protection system, HVAC, and plumbing installations from the design stage until occupancy by the owner. Madera Mechanical is a member of the Alliance of Construction Trades, the Arizona PHCC and the Nevada PHCC. We are involved in and committed to apprenticeship training for all our trades in both states. These certified apprenticeship programs, along with the on-the-job training obtained from our skilled journeyman craftsmen, will insure that our work force can continue to grow and perform using qualified personnel.
